GreenPan Size Guide – Which Pan Size Fits Your Cooking?

GreenPan cookware ranges from single-serving mini pans to large family-size pots. The right size depends on how many people you cook for, what you're making, and your stovetop burner size.

  • Small (5–8 in): best for eggs, single portions, sauces, and sides. Example: the GreenPan Mini Healthy Ceramic Nonstick 5" Egg Pan (pink) or an 8-inch frypan.
  • Medium (9.5–10 in): everyday workhorses for 2-4 servings – sautéed vegetables, chicken breasts, omelets. Most popular size in sets.
  • Large (11–12 in): family meals, stir-fries, and one-pan dinners. A 12-inch frypan holds enough for 4-6 servings.
  • Extra-large (18 x 11 in double burner griddles, 8 qt stockpots): for batch cooking, meal prep, or feeding a crowd. Check your stovetop clearance and oven capacity.
  • Depth matters: saucepans and stockpots are taller for liquids; frypans and sauté pans have wider, shallower profiles for browning and flipping.

GreenPan Material Options – Ceramic Nonstick, Hard Anodized, Stainless Steel & More

GreenPan's material choices affect heat performance, durability, maintenance, and which cooktops you can use. Here's how to pick the right one for your cooking habits.

  • PFAS-free Ceramic Nonstick (Thermolon): the brand's signature – non-toxic, easy cleanup, requires low to medium heat. Best for eggs, fish, pancakes, and delicate foods. Oven safe to 350°F–600°F depending on the line.
  • Hard Anodized Aluminum: extra scratch-resistant body, often paired with ceramic nonstick. Ideal for metal utensil use and daily high-volume cooking.
  • Stainless Steel (tri-ply or uncoated): superior searing, browning, and induction performance; heavier weight. Great for professional-style cooking and oven-to-table.
  • Carbon Steel (pre-seasoned): develops a natural nonstick patina; lightweight and responsive to high heat. Perfect for woks, paella, and outdoor cooking.
  • Diamond-Infused / Diamond-Reinforced: ceramic nonstick with added diamond particles for 10x longer-lasting release – found in Valencia Pro, Chatham, and Reserve lines.
  • Enameled Cast Iron (Bobby Flay line): retains heat evenly, ideal for braising, roasting, and slow cooking. Oven safe to 500°F.

Before You Buy – Final Fit Checklist

Double-check these three things to make sure your attribute choices work together for your kitchen and cooking style.

  • Stovetop Compatibility: induction cooktops require magnetic stainless steel or induction-ready bases – look for 'induction ready' in product tags. All GreenPan nonstick sets work on gas, electric, and ceramic glass; some are induction compatible.
  • Oven Safety: check the oven-safe temperature (usually 350°F–600°F) and whether lids, handles, and coatings can handle broiler or high heat. Glass lids typically top out at 350°F–425°F.

What size GreenPan should I buy for everyday cooking?

A 10-inch or 9.5-inch frypan is the most versatile for 2-4 people – it fits on a standard burner, handles eggs, vegetables, and chicken breasts, and is large enough for one-pan meals. If you cook for 4 or more, add an 11-inch or 12-inch frypan and a 5-quart sauté pan or stockpot.

Which GreenPan material is easiest to care for?

PFAS-free ceramic nonstick (Thermolon) is the easiest – food slides off, most pieces are dishwasher-safe, and you typically only need low to medium heat. Hard anodized ceramic nonstick adds scratch resistance for metal utensil use. Stainless steel requires a little more technique for searing but is dishwasher-safe and induction compatible.

Are GreenPan colors purely cosmetic, or do they affect performance?

Color is cosmetic for the cookware body and handles – performance is identical across colors within the same line. Some colors like dark exteriors (black, navy, twilight blue) may hide oil splatters better than light finishes (cream, taupe, blush pink). Gold-tone and stainless steel handles are purely aesthetic.
